A cup is being filled with water. The cup is 10 cm tall, has an 8-cm diameter base, and 18-cm diameter opening. How fast is the volume (mL/s) of water increasing when the depth of the water is increasing 4 cm/s at a depth of 2 cm? A. 204 B. 254 C. 284 D. 314
